Strategic Analysis

Helios Towers plc • 2026

Helios Towers plc operates an independent telecom infrastructure model focused on owning and operating tower assets, primarily in Africa, where demand for mobile coverage remains structurally high. Its value proposition is based on long-term exposure to connectivity, with revenues backed by essential assets and a shared-infrastructure model that allows multiple operators to use the same network.

Strengths
  • Positioning in critical infrastructure that is difficult to replicate at scale
  • Exposure to the structural growth in mobile usage and network coverage in Africa
  • Asset-heavy model providing better operational visibility than integrated telecom operators
Weaknesses
  • Dependence on telecom operators' investment spending and financial strength
  • Exposure to regulatory, political, and currency risks specific to African markets
